Russian officials again with disinformation Patrushev: Ukraine, not ISIS, is behind terrorist attack in Moscow

The Secretary of Russia’s Security Council, Nikolai Patrushev, has misinformed that Ukraine, not ISIS, was behind the attack on Crocus City Hall in Russia. He dismissed factual statements by Western officials that ISIS was responsible for the attack.

What did Patrushev say?


“Ukraine is behind the terrorist attack on Crocus City Hall.

When Russian journalists asked him whether ISIS or Ukraine was behind the terrorist attack. Patrushev replied: “Of course, Ukraine.

Analysis:

Russia has wanted to blame Ukraine for the terrorist attack near Moscow since the night of the attack, when nothing was known. ISIS has publicly claimed responsibility for the attack and the arrested suspects are part of the Islamic group. However, Russia continues to falsely accuse Ukraine of being behind the attack. The US National Security Council clarified that “ISIS bears sole responsibility for this attack” and that “there was no Ukrainian involvement”. US officials have confirmed that intelligence officials have been gathering information for months suggesting that ISIS may be planning an attack with mass casualties in Russia. Russian President Vladimir Putin falsely suggested that the attackers were attempting to flee to Ukraine. Ukraine has strongly denied any involvement. The Moscow court identified the alleged attackers through a post on the Telegram network as Dalerdzhon Mirzoyev, Saidakrami Rachabalizoda, Shamsidin Fariduni and Mukhammadsobir Faizov. Two of them, Mirzoyev and Rachabalizoda, pleaded guilty. According to Russian media, all four suspects were citizens of the former Soviet republic of Tajikistan and lived in Russia.
